Gaku Nakagawa has been a self-taught harpsichord, clavichord, and organ player while studying piano from an early age. While still a student at the University of Tokyo, he won first prize in the keyboard instrument category at the 27th International Competition of Ancient Music in Yamanashi in 2014, and since 2016 he has been studying harpsichord with Glenn Wilson at the Würzburg Conservatory, further refining his musicality. Although this collection of Telemann’s works is titled “Ouverture,” it is really a small suite that combines the first overture with two dances. Interspersed throughout the work are dances from Italy, Germany, and France, giving the piece a diverse look. Some of the pieces seem to have been influenced by the folk music of Poland, where Telemann stayed for a time, making this a truly interesting collection.Naxos Japan
